Using brain test markers in a cancer clinic visit

Neurocognitive Disorders

Part of Mental health clinical trials.

This study adds special brain “biomarker” tests into routine visits for adults with brain tumors. It may help the clinic better track these cancers over time and tailor care.

Who can take part

  • You are 18 years or older and have a brain tumor (either a primary brain cancer or brain metastases)
  • You are being followed at Miami Cancer Institute (MCI) after brain cancer treatment
  • Your treatment included one or more of: brain radiation, surgery, and/or anti-cancer medicines
  • Your doctor expects you may live at least 6 more months
  • You are willing to take part in an ongoing registration study
  • Your brain radiation was for cancer, not for a non-cancer condition
